Caught some nice big walleyes on Lake Erie on Sunday/monday. Man I love 'em on the grill. I use Reynolds "release" non stick foil. Mop the fillets with melted real butter, then season as you like. I just used some Sylvia's lemon/pepper on these. mmmmm good!
